Recalls NHTSA · verified

Showing 2 of 2 campaigns on record for this vehicle.

87V022000Vehicle Speed ControlReported 25/02/1987

CRUISE CONTROL MODULE COULD HAVE INCONSISTENT CRUISE CONTROL OPERATION. Remedy: REPLACE MODULE, AS NECESSARY.

87V178000Visibility:Glass, Side/RearReported 23/11/1987

THE KEY OPERATED TAILGATE WINDOW WILL CONTINUE TO CLOSE IF THE SPRING LOADED KEY DOES NOT RETURN TO OFF POSITION WHEN RELEASED. Remedy: OWNERS SHOULD NOT LEAVE KEY IN TAILGATE OF UNATTENDED VEHICLE. REPAIR MECHANISM TO ASSURE PROPER KEY RETURN OPERATION.

Frequently asked

How much oil does the 1987 Grand Wagoneer take?

4 qt w/ filter of ABOVE 30 degrees F: 20W-40 OR 20W-50 API, ABOVE 0 degrees F: 10W-30 OR 10W-40 API, BELOW 60 degrees F: 5W-30 API, per the factory manual.
